本文目录导读:
图片来源于网络,如有侵权联系删除
《关闭虚拟化安全性的详细指南》
理解虚拟化安全性
虚拟化安全性是现代计算机系统中一项重要的安全特性,旨在保护虚拟化环境免受各种威胁,如恶意软件利用虚拟机漏洞进行攻击、虚拟机之间的非法数据访问等,在某些特定场景下,例如进行特定的兼容性测试、解决某些软件与虚拟化安全功能的冲突时,可能需要关闭虚拟化安全性,但需要注意的是,关闭这一功能会使系统面临一定的安全风险,所以应谨慎操作。
二、在Windows系统中关闭虚拟化安全性(以Windows 10为例)
(一)通过系统设置
1、进入BIOS/UEFI设置
- 重启计算机,在开机过程中,根据屏幕提示按下对应的按键(常见的有Del、F2、F10等)进入BIOS或UEFI设置界面,不同的计算机品牌和型号进入BIOS/UEFI的方式可能有所不同,联想电脑可能是F1或Fn + F1,惠普电脑可能是F10等。
- 在BIOS/UEFI设置中,找到与“虚拟化”相关的选项,这可能被标记为“Virtualization Technology”“VT - x”(对于Intel处理器)或者“AMD - V”(对于AMD处理器)等。
- 将其设置为“Disabled”(禁用)状态,保存设置并退出BIOS/UEFI设置界面,通常是按下F10键保存并退出。
2、组策略编辑器(适用于Windows 10专业版、企业版等)
- 按下Win+R键,打开“运行”对话框,输入“gpedit.msc”并回车,打开组策略编辑器。
- 在组策略编辑器中,依次展开“计算机配置”->“管理模板”->“系统”->“Device Guard”。
- 找到“启用基于虚拟化的安全性”选项,双击打开它。
- 在弹出的属性窗口中,选择“已禁用”选项,然后点击“确定”。
图片来源于网络,如有侵权联系删除
(二)通过注册表编辑器(风险较高,操作需谨慎)
1、按下Win+R键,打开“运行”对话框,输入“regedit”并回车,打开注册表编辑器。
2、在注册表中找到“H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Control\DeviceGuard”键值。
3、如果没有“DeviceGuard”键值,可以右键单击“Control”键,选择“新建”->“项”,并将其命名为“DeviceGuard”。
4、在“DeviceGuard”项下,创建一个名为“RequirePlatformSecurityFeatures”的DWORD(32位)值。
5、将“RequirePlatformSecurityFeatures”的值设置为0,修改注册表后,需要重启计算机才能使设置生效。
三、在Linux系统中关闭虚拟化安全性(以Ubuntu为例)
(一)KVM虚拟化环境
1、检查当前虚拟化安全设置
- 打开终端,输入命令“virsh list --all”查看当前运行和未运行的虚拟机列表。
- 对于基于KVM的虚拟机,可以查看虚拟机的XML配置文件,虚拟机名为“vm1”,则可以通过命令“virsh dumpxml vm1 > vm1.xml”将其配置文件导出到当前目录下的“vm1.xml”文件中。
- 在“vm1.xml”文件中,查找与安全相关的标签,如“<seclabel type='dynamic' model='dac' relabel='yes'/>”等。
2、修改配置文件以关闭安全性相关设置
图片来源于网络,如有侵权联系删除
- 根据需要,可以修改XML配置文件中的安全标签,将安全标签中的相关属性进行调整或者直接删除安全标签(这种操作需要谨慎,因为可能影响虚拟机的正常运行和安全性)。
- 修改完成后,使用命令“virsh define vm1.xml”重新定义虚拟机的配置。
(二)Xen虚拟化环境
1、编辑Xen配置文件
- 在Ubuntu系统中,Xen的配置文件通常位于“/etc/xen/”目录下,对于特定的虚拟机配置文件“vm - config”,使用文本编辑器(如“nano”或“vi”)打开该文件。
- 在配置文件中,查找与安全相关的参数,如“security - context”等。
2、调整安全参数
- 将与安全相关的参数设置为较低的安全级别或者直接注释掉(在参数行前面添加“#”符号),如果有“security - context='high - security'”,可以将其修改为“security - context='low - security'”或者直接注释掉这一行。
- 保存配置文件后,需要重启Xen相关服务或者重新启动虚拟机才能使设置生效,可以使用命令“service xen restart”或者“reboot”(如果需要重启整个系统)。
关闭虚拟化安全性是一项需要谨慎对待的操作,在进行操作之前,应该充分评估可能带来的安全风险,并确保操作是在合法、合规且安全可控的环境下进行,如果在操作过程中遇到任何问题,如系统无法正常启动、虚拟机运行异常等,应及时恢复之前的设置或者寻求专业的技术支持。
评论列表